Abstract

Cervical cancer is the third most common type of cancer in women, and still an important cause of death in this group. Its natural history, and the existence of effective screening methods, allows detection and treatment of pre-cancerous lesions. Some cases, despite adequate treatment, develop recurrence or even cervical cancer, showing the need of treatment and follow up. Objective: To evaluate clinical and pathologic factors associated to recurrence of disease in women treated with electrosurgical conization for treatment of cervical intraepithelial neoplasia. Methods: Retrospective review of medical records of 342 patients who had undergone conization due to CIN 2 or 3 and have adequate follow up. Chi square test for heterogeneity or trend was used to estimate the strength of the univariate association between the factors under study and each of the two outcome variables. A p value < 0,05 was considered statistically significant. The multivariate associations were estimated by multiple logistic regression analysis (backward stepwise selection). An odds ratio with a 95% confidence interval that did not include the unity was considered stastitically significant. (AU)
